Japan pledges 'maximum' support for Ukraine at its recovery conference

Delegates from countries at the Ukraine Recovery Conference have outlined their plans to help the country rebuild from the devastation inflicted by Russia's invasion.

Japan's State Minister for Foreign Affairs Suzuki Takako was among the delegates who spoke on Tuesday at the event in Lugano, southern Switzerland. Representatives from the governments of Ukraine and about 40 other countries are taking part. The World Bank and other international bodies are also participating.

Suzuki promised that her country would continue maximum support for Ukraine in cooperation with the international community.

Suzuki recalled how Japan rebuilt its economy after being reduced to ruins in World War Two. She also touched on the country's experience of having to recover from numerous natural disasters, including the 2011 earthquake and tsunami.

She suggested that Japan will share the lessons it has learned and actively contribute to Ukraine's recovery.

The Ukrainian government has stressed the country needs roughly 750 billion dollars at this point for restoration and rebuilding efforts.

The Ukrainians see the conference as a starting point. Numerous countries have promised support, but it's unclear how costly restoration and rebuilding projects can be carried out as no end is in sight to Russia's invasion.

The two-day event is set to wrap up later on Tuesday with a news conference by Swiss President Ignazio Cassis and Ukrainian Prime Minister Denys Shmyhal.
